Hidden Track
Losing Streak features a hidden track accessible only by rewinding the CD about a minute and a half before the beginning of track 1. The track features banter spoken by former band mascot "Howie J. Reynolds", an elderly Gainesville local, similar in concept to Sublime's recorded rantings of a mentally ill man on Robbin' the Hood. This leads into track 1, which begins with him stating, "This is the old dude, Howie J. Reynolds, and you're listening to "Less Than Jake".
Not all CDs have this hidden track.
